Did you know ?

Grantown-on-Spey, nestled in the heart of the Scottish Highlands, is much more than just a picturesque town. It holds a significant place in the history of Scotland's forestry industry. The town is home to Anagach Woods, a forest that has stood for over 250 years. It was planted by none other than James Grant, the founder of Grantown-on-Spey in the 18th century. This ancient woodland, covering 586 hectares, comprises mostly Scots Pine but also includes birch, rowan, and juniper trees. Visitors can explore its numerous trails and might even spot roe deer, red squirrels and a variety of bird species, making it a living testament to Scotland's rich biodiversity.

The verdant town of Grantown-on-Spey, nestled in the heart of the Scottish Highlands, is a place steeped in history and natural beauty. This picturesque town, founded in 1765 by Sir James Grant, sits on the northern edge of the Cairngorms National Park and is surrounded by ancient woodland, making it a haven for outdoor enthusiasts and history buffs alike.

From its Georgian and Victorian architecture to the meandering River Spey that gives the town its name, Grantown-on-Spey is a testament to Scotland's rich heritage. The town was strategically established as a centre for linen production, a legacy ingrained in the fabric of its community. Today, Grantown-on-Spey is an important hub for tourism, renowned for its salmon fishing, hiking trails, and the annual Spirit of Speyside Whisky Festival.

Fun Fact !

Adding to its charm and historical significance, Grantown-on-Spey is also known for its unique cultural heritage. It has a vibrant music scene which is deeply rooted in the Celtic tradition. The town hosts the annual 'Speyfest', a three-day festival of traditional and contemporary Celtic music featuring top international artists as well as local talents. Unique to Grantown-on-Spey, Speyfest is the biggest event of its kind in the Moray Speyside region, attracting music lovers from all over the world. This event not only celebrates the rich musical culture of the town but also contributes significantly to its local economy.


Wikipedia Says

Grantown-on-Spey (Scottish Gaelic: Baile nan Granndach) is a town in the Highland Council Area, historically within the county of Moray. It is located on a low plateau at Freuchie beside the river Spey at the northern edge of the Cairngorm mountains, about 20 miles (32 km) south-east of Inverness (35 miles or 56 km by road). The town was founded in 1765 as a planned settlement, and was originally called simply Grantown after Sir James Grant. The addition 'on Spey' was added by the burgh council in 1898. The town has several listed 18th and 19th century buildings, including several large hotels, and serves as a regional centre for tourism and services in the Strathspey region. The town is twinned with Notre-Dame-de-Monts in the Vendée, Pays de la Loire, France.
